What happened to the first 7 Games Hanako games made?
I did some digging and realized Hanako Games had 7 titles from 2003-2005. The titles being Charm School, Sweet Dreams, Goblin Garden, Classroom Chaos, Shoujo Circus, Pentagrpah, and Summer Schoolgirls.

And I wanted to check into them to see how far this company has truely come, but their website no longer has the links up for these old games, they are not selling them on Iciti.o like the rest like Cute Knight and Fatal Hearts. (Cute Knight and Summer Schoolgirls were developed alongside each other and released very close to the date of each other too going by old logs on their website).

I can find no offical message for these games being removed from their site, or why they might have removed them at all. The Fourms on Hanako games don't really have a section for a question like this and their sub is locked down. So I was hoping someone here might know what happened? Hanako Games  [developer] Nov 27, 2020 @ 2:00pm 
The main answer is that they are so old that they a) probably don't run on any modern computers and b) tend to be ugly and not really in keeping with what people would expect.

Many of those are simple Game Maker experiments that have very basic gameplay and possibly no text. Some of those were never for sale at all, they were posted for free and later removed.

As they're not good advertising (being nothing like my current games AND not nice to look at) and I cannot provide any sort of tech support to make them run anymore, it was better to quietly shuffle them out of sight.

Anyone REALLY dedicated can snoop around and manage to find links to purchase the ones that ever were for sale, but that's entirely at your own risk. I can't promise that anything will run and I can't help you if it doesn't.

Fatal Hearts is available on Itch (as well as still technically for sale on Big Fish Games and possibly other places I've lost track of).

If it weren't for all the puzzles it would be tempting to make a remastered version for fun, but since each puzzle is unique and based on things I could do with the tool I was using at the time, trying to code a replacement in another engine would be a tall order.
